How, What, and When to feed an abandoned baby bird. Ideally, we recommend putting the baby bird back into its nest, leaving it alone for the parent birds to feed it, or getting it to a licensed bird rehabber. Only if these options are not available, and your baby bird is truly orphaned, should you intervene and feed him. This video should be helpful!

Bro… every 20 minutes? Are you sure about this? How can one do this all night if they are trying to save a found baby bird? Your telling me that if someone on their own was trying to save a baby bird and that person falls asleep for a couple hours…. you are telling me that bird will most likely die?
@mikeyfranz
@mikeyfranz Месяц назад
Great question! No, they only eat during the daylight hours. At night time, once it is dark, they will sleep through the night, and start chirping for food again at Sun up, likely around 7 AM. For this reason it is important to make sure that their room is dark at night, you can't leave a light on, or they may think it is still daytime. Also, bear in mind, that "every 20 minutes" feeding--- will shrink down to every 30 minutes, then every 45 minutes, then every hour, then every two hours, as they develop rapidly over the next couple of weeks. The good news is, the bird will kinda inform you of when it's time to eat, because they wake up and start chirping for food. Then you feed them, and once they are full they fall asleep until they're hungry again.
